Hull City Council is looking for a dedicated individual to manage a Children's Home within Hull, ensuring a safe and supportive environment for children. Responsibilities include compliance with statutory obligations, leading a team, and working with partners to improve services.
The successful candidate will enjoy a competitive salary of £50,269.00 to £53,460.00 per annum, excellent benefits including a strong pension scheme and generous leave policy.

How to prepare for a job interview at Hull City Council
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you’re well-versed in the statutory obligations related to children's homes. Brush up on relevant legislation and best practices in child care. This will show that you’re not just passionate but also knowledgeable about the field.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ully led a team in the past. Think about challenges you faced and how you overcame them. This is your chance to demonstrate your ability to inspire and manage a team effectively.
✨Understand the Community
Research Hull City Council and its initiatives related to children's services. Being familiar with local partnerships and community needs will help you articulate how you can contribute to improving services in the area.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ions to ask during the interview. This could be about their current strategies or how they measure success in their children's home. It shows your genuine interest and helps you gauge if the role is right for you.
